Summary
TLDRIn this video, the speaker exposes the fraudulent practices commonly used by developers in the real estate industry, particularly focusing on the misleading 'UI process' (likely referring to 'Unit Inventory'). They explain how developers use high-pressure tactics, fear of missing out (FOMO), and false promises to manipulate potential buyers into making rushed decisions. The speaker advises caution, emphasizing the importance of clear communication, written agreements, and personal satisfaction before committing to a property purchase. They stress the need for transparency and fairness in all real estate dealings to avoid being scammed.
Takeaways
- 😀 Be cautious of fraudulent UI processes in real estate, where developers create false urgency to manipulate buyers.
- 😀 Developers may ask for large payments (₹10-50 lakhs) upfront with promises of exclusive deals, but these offers are often scams.
- 😀 Don't fall for the 'Fear of Missing Out' tactic that pushes you to make rushed decisions without full knowledge.
- 😀 Always prioritize your needs over wants when choosing a property and stick to a fixed budget and location.
- 😀 If a developer refuses to give clear information on pricing, location, and charges, it's a red flag.
- 😀 Pressure tactics from developers to rush decisions or offer discounted prices are part of a scam to create false urgency.
- 😀 Always ask for written documentation from developers, especially regarding pricing, charges, and terms and conditions.
- 😀 In case of fraud or unfair practices, having a written agreement or email can help protect your rights.
- 😀 Never accept a project as 'sold out' without verifying all details, as developers might try to push unwanted deals.
- 😀 Real estate consultants who prioritize transparency and fairness can help you navigate the market safely.
- 😀 Take your time when making property decisions—ensure you're fully satisfied with the deal and that it provides value for money.
Q & A
What is the primary warning about the UI process in real estate as discussed in the transcript?
-The primary warning is that the UI process in real estate is fraudulent and a scam. Developers use high-pressure tactics, false promises, and manipulated pricing to deceive customers into making hasty and ill-informed decisions.
How do developers mislead customers during the UI process?
-Developers often create a fear of missing out (FOMO) by pressuring customers to make quick decisions. They promise limited-time offers and discounts, and if customers don't act fast, they are told they will lose the opportunity. However, these promises are often fake or manipulated.
What role does the UI process play in the pricing of real estate projects?
-The UI process is used by developers to set higher prices for real estate projects. They may initially offer a lower price to entice customers, but once the UI process begins, the prices are inflated, including additional charges that were not disclosed upfront.
How can customers protect themselves from falling into the trap of the UI process?
-Customers should stick to their fixed budget and requirements, avoid being influenced by offers or promises from developers, and clearly communicate their needs. They should also ask for detailed pricing and transparency before committing to any deal.
What happens if a customer decides to participate in the UI process and then regrets it?
-If customers regret their participation, they may find that the prices have been increased, and the property they were initially interested in is no longer available at the original price. Some developers may also refuse refunds or fail to return the customer's money promptly.
What is the significance of a developer’s track record in avoiding UI scams?
-A developer's track record is crucial in ensuring transparency and honesty in real estate deals. Developers with a good track record are less likely to engage in deceptive practices and are more likely to provide a fair and straightforward transaction.
How does the urgency and pressure tactics used by developers during the UI process affect customers?
-The urgency and pressure tactics push customers to make hasty decisions, leading them to overpay or buy properties that do not meet their needs. These tactics exploit customers' fear of missing out, which can result in poor financial decisions.
What advice is given to customers to ensure they are making an informed real estate purchase?
-Customers should carefully plan their purchase by determining their exact needs and requirements. They should not be swayed by aggressive sales tactics and should insist on getting all the details in writing, including the final cost and any additional charges.
How should customers handle the situation if a developer refuses to disclose pricing and details upfront?
-If a developer refuses to disclose the pricing and project details, it is a red flag. Customers should walk away and look for another developer who is transparent and willing to provide all necessary information.
What are the key signs that a real estate deal might be a scam?
-Key signs of a scam include sudden price hikes, lack of transparency, high-pressure sales tactics, refusal to provide clear and detailed pricing, and demands for large upfront payments with no guarantees. If something seems too good to be true, it likely is.
